Sewage water claims usually need a sewer-backup endorsement on your Braddock Heights homeowner policy. Standard coverage won't touch it. Our cleanup documentation captures the contamination source, the Category 3 classification, the regulated disposal trail, and biocide chemistry records. That's the evidence carriers want to approve an endorsement-driven claim.

What equipment do you use for sewage water cleanup in Braddock Heights properties?
Every Braddock Heights sewage water cleanup call gets a full IICRC-spec equipment loadout: truck-mounted vacuum extractors (thousands of gallons per hour throughput), low-grain refrigerant (LGR) dehumidifiers calibrated for water damage drying, axial and centrifugal air movers placed by chamber-math formula, pin and pinless moisture meters, thermal imaging cameras for hidden-moisture detection, HEPA air scrubbers for occupied spaces, and EPA-registered antimicrobials.
How much does sewage water cleanup cost in Braddock Heights, MD?
Cost in Braddock Heights depends on water category (Category 1 clean water is least expensive, Category 3 black water requires hazmat protocols), affected square footage, and materials involved. What should I do before your crew arrives at my Braddock Heights property?
If safe, shut off the water source at the main valve. Move valuables, electronics, and furniture out of the affected area to prevent further damage. Don't use household appliances or fans on wet electrical outlets. Document the damage with photos before mitigation begins for your insurance claim.
